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Results 1 to 2 of 2
  1. #1
    New to the CF scene
    Join Date
    Jun 2003
    Location
    Chicago, IL
    Posts
    2
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Question having trouble making objects static

    yeah.... i know, im supposed to search javascriptkit.com. well i did, thats where the problem comes in. i got the code for statically placing objects, and im trying to use the "spinmenu.js" but the three codes dont seem to be collaborating. ive been working on this since 6:00pm central time yesterday, and i needed it then too. ive tried all the variables that my mouse could muster. could somebody point me in the right direction?

    heres the code im "trying" to use:
    dosc:

    <script language="JavaScript1.2">
    document.write("Your browser\'s dimensions are: ")
    //if browser supports window.innerWidth
    if (window.innerWidth)
    document.write(window.innerWidth+" by "+window.innerHeight)
    //else if browser supports document.all (IE 4+)
    else if (document.all)
    document.write(document.body.clientWidth+" by "+document.body.clientHeight)

    </script>


    variables for banner:

    <div id="staticbanner" style="position:absolute;">
    Advertisement<br>
    <a href="http://test.htm"><img
    src="test.gif" width="120" height="90" alt="Click here!"
    border="0"></a>
    </div>

    <script>
    //define universal reference to "staticbanner"
    var crossobj=document.all? document.all.staticbanner : document.getElementById? document.getElementById("staticbanner") : document.staticbanner

    function positionit(){
    //define universal dsoc left point
    var dsocleft=document.all? document.body.scrollLeft : pageXOffset
    //define universal dsoc top point
    var dsoctop=document.all? document.body.scrollTop : pageYOffset
    //define universal browser window width
    var window_width=document.all? document.body.clientWidth : window.innerWidth

    //if the user is using IE 4+ or NS6+
    if (document.all||document.getElementById){
    crossobj.style.left=parseInt(dsocleft)+
    parseInt(window_width)-135
    crossobj.style.top=dsoctop+5
    }
    //else if the user is using NS 4
    else if (document.layers){
    crossobj.left=
    dsocleft+window_width-140
    crossobj.top=dsoctop+15
    }
    }
    setInterval("positionit()",200)
    </script>
    Last edited by hustla21519; 06-02-2003 at 08:34 PM.

  • #2
    New to the CF scene
    Join Date
    Jun 2003
    Location
    Chicago, IL
    Posts
    2
    Thanks
    0
    Thanked 0 Times in 0 Posts
    and heres the spinmenu from javascriptkit:

    <embed><html>
    <head>
    <!--Step 1: Add the below SCRIPT to the head of your page:-->
    <script type="text/javascript" src="spinmenu.js"></script>
    </head>

    <body>
    <p>Example Spin Menu:</p>

    <!--Step 2: Add the below SCRIPT to the body of your page where you want it to appear:-->

    <script type="text/javascript">

    /*
    3D Spin Menu- By Petre Stefan (http://www.eyecon.ro) w/ changes by JK
    Visit JavaScript Kit (http://www.javascriptkit.com) for script
    Keep this notice intact!
    */

    eye.isVertical = 0; //if it's vertical or horizontal [0|1]
    eye.x = 500; // x offset from point of insertion on page
    eye.y = 250; // y offset from point of insertion on page
    eye.w = 150; // item's width
    eye.h = 30; // height
    eye.r = 100; // menu's radius
    eye.v = 20; // velocity
    eye.s = 8; // scale in space (for 3D effect)
    eye.color = '#ffffff'; // normal text color
    eye.colorover = '#ffffff'; // mouseover text color
    eye.backgroundcolor = '#0099ff'; // normal background color
    eye.backgroundcolorover = '#990000'; // mouseover background color
    eye.bordercolor = '#000000'; //border color
    eye.fontsize = 12; // font size
    eye.fontfamily = 'Arial'; //font family
    if (document.getElementById){
    document.write('<div id="spinanchor" style="height:'+eval(eye.h+20)+'"></div>')
    eye.anchor=document.getElementById('spinanchor')
    eye.spinmenu();
    eye.x+=getposOffset(eye.anchor, "left") //relatively position it
    eye.y+=getposOffset(eye.anchor, "top") //relatively position it

    //menuitem: eye.spinmenuitem(text, link, target)
    eye.spinmenuitem("JavaScript Kit","http://www.javascriptkit.com");
    eye.spinmenuitem("Free JavaScripts","http://www.javascriptkit.com/cutpastejava.shtml");
    eye.spinmenuitem("JS Tutorials","http://www.javascriptkit.com/javaindex.shtml");
    eye.spinmenuitem("Advanced JS Tutorials","http://www.javascriptkit.com/javatutors/");
    eye.spinmenuitem("DHTML/ CSS Tutorials","http://www.javascriptkit.com/dhtmltutors/index.shtml");
    eye.spinmenuitem("Web building tutorials","http://www.javascriptkit.com/howto/");
    eye.spinmenuclose();
    }
    </script>

    <p align="left"><font face="arial" size="-2">This free script provided by<br>
    <a href="http://javascriptkit.com">JavaScript Kit</a></font></p>

    </body></embed>


    i dont want anybody to do it for me, i just figured itd be alot easier to diagnose the problem if you could see the script
    thanks


  •  

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•